Contains photos and video from 808 #16, Contour Roam and Crocolis Extreme Cam.

808 is OK but kind of a pain to fiddle with and not waterproof or durable.

Contour Roam is great, though non-removable battery is a little sub-optimal (other Contours have removable batteries) and I really wish they'd add loop recording, every other camera even the $38 808 #16 HD have this. Also on the Roam at least the need to connect to a computer to erase prior recordings and change the settings is kind of a pain.

Crocolis has pretty much all the features and uses a VERY cheap ($5 on ebay) Fuji camera battery and takes standard SD, but is a little big and heavy. I'm OK with it but many would not be, and it's not at all stealth.

I'm not sure what I'd buy right now. It would probably be one of the latter two, but I'd be hard pressed to choose right now.
